Paced breathing and respiratory movement responses evoked by bidirectional constant current stimulation in anesthetized rabbits
Objective: Diaphragm pacing (DP) is a long-term and effective respiratory assist therapy for patients with central alveolar hypoventilation and high cervical spinal cord injury.
